Windows Essential Business Server 2008 R2 (known in development as Windows Essential Business Server v2, abbreviated as EBS v2) was a canceled project that was originally planned to be the next generation of Windows Essential Business Server 2008. This operating system is only mentioned on the Technet blog, and in a post titled "Our Technical Findings While Developing EBS v2", published on 7 April 2010, it was mentioned that "due to external factors, EBS v2 was not released to the public".[1] It is known that the codename of this canceled operating system is "Cascades". It is based on Windows Server 2008 R2.
Compared to Windows Essential Business Server 2008, the number of EBS v2 installation images has increased from 1 to 5. EBS v2 simplifies the number of keys: now there are only two key sets in the system, the Management Server uses one set of keys, and the Virtual Host Server, the Messaging Server and the Security Server use common keys.
